About Forza Font Family


Succinct geometries make for an expressive type family that’s ardent, disciplined, shrewd, and commanding.

The Forza typeface was designed by Jonathan Hoefler in 2006. A sans serif adaptation of Hoefler’s Vitesse typeface (2000), the central motif of both typefaces is a soft-cornered barrel shape, which affords opportunities for both long straightaways and quick turns. Forza was created for Wired magazine, in whose pages the typeface first appeared in 2006.

Forza. Articulate meets assertive.

Some of the world’s most complex typography can be found in magazines. Their formal requirements are daunting — even the simplest magazine includes listings, tables, complex navigation systems, and painterly display typography — but even more daunting are the multitude of editorial voices that they require. A title such as Wired might take “technology” as its theme, but it covers technological topics from cultural, political, commercial, social, and philosophical perspectives. Science requires a different voice than science fiction, as do lofty prognostications and down-to-earth service pieces. The title that includes all of these needs an especially acrobatic family of fonts.

About Hoefler & Co.

Famous for designing long-lived typefaces marked by high performance and high style, Hoefler&Co creates the fonts that give voice to the world’s foremost institutions, publications, causes, and brands. With a library of 1,500 fonts designed for print, web, office, and mobile fonts, Hoefler&Co is everywhere. Their typefaces shaped the presidential campaigns of Barack Obama and Joe Biden; they’re on the cornerstone of One World Trade Center and on every iPhone ever made. They serve brands from Delta Air Lines to Tiffany & Co., publications from Harper’s Bazaar to The New York Times, institutions such as the Guggenheim Museum, The Public Theater, and New York University, and non-profit organizations including the Natural Resources Defense Council, the Southern Poverty Law Center, and The Peconic Land Trust.
